It's estimated that four out of five people dislike what they do for a living--and many hate their jobs. Think of it. The majority of us would rather be doing almost anything else with the forty, fifty, even sixty hours a week we spend at work. At The Career Clinic, we think that's a shame. And that's why we hope you'll join us for a new radio talk show! Think of it as your personal career counselor, one who wants to help you find work you're passionate about--and can offer you suggestions for getting out of the rut you may be in now. We talk to experts with advice on everything from discovering what you're good at to negotiating a salary once you've been offered a position. We also talk with people who've already found their dream job--who have tips on how you can, too.

The Career Clinic is a radio talk show and a vignette. The talk program originates from WZFG AM 1100 "The Flag" in Fargo, and airs on 89 stations across the country. You can also listen to the podcast. The vignette also airs on the American Forces Network, and you can listen on the player here. Or check our station list for an affiliate near you.

More Books

Maureen has also written two other books. Staying the Course: A Runner's Toughest Race, with Dick Beardsley, chronicles the former marathon champion's life from unknown high school runner through a very public battle with drug addiction. Left for Dead: A Second Life after Vietnam, with Jon Hovde, is another story of a life rebuilt--but this time from the vantage point of a combat-wounded soldier.
